Understanding Your Needs: The Three Key Considerations

Before diving into specific racking types, let's explore the three crucial factors that influence your decision:

  • Storage Capacity: How much inventory do you need to store? Are you looking to maximize space utilization or prioritize easy access to specific items?
  • Product Flow: Do your products follow a first-in, first-out (FIFO) system, like perishables, or a last-in, first-out (LIFO) approach for non-essentials?
  • Pallet Accessibility: How often will you need to access individual pallets?

By considering these questions, you can narrow down the ideal racking system for your specific warehouse operation.

The Racking Roll Call: Unveiling the Major Players

Now, let's meet the champions of the warehouse storage arena:

  • Selective Pallet Racking: The All-Around MVP

Imagine a classic bookshelf, but supersized and industrial-strength. That's selective racking in a nutshell. It's the most popular option for its versatility. Selective racking offers several advantages, including the ability to adapt to various pallet sizes with adjustable pallet racking options and easy access to individual units.

Individual pallets rest on horizontal beams supported by vertical uprights. This system provides direct access to every pallet, making it ideal for FIFO inventory flow and frequent picking.

  • Double Deep Racking: The Space-Saving Strategist

Think of double deep racking as selective racking's space-saving cousin. Here, two pallets are stored per bay, one behind the other. Maximizing storage density requires specialized forklifts to access the rear pallets. This system is best suited for warehouses with low pick frequency and LIFO inventory flow.

  • Push-back and Carton Flow Racking: The Gravity Groove

These dynamic duos utilize gravity to streamline product movement. Push-back racking features slightly angled bays where pallets rest on rollers. Adding a new pallet pushes the older one back, ensuring a LIFO flow. Carton flow racking works similarly but with angled shelves for smaller items like boxes. Both systems are perfect for high-volume warehouses with consistent product flow.

  • Drive-In and Drive-Thru Racking: The High-Density Specialists

These heavyweights offer the ultimate storage density. Pallets are loaded directly into bays, creating a network of storage lanes. Drive-in systems offer single access points, while drive-thru allows entry and exit from both ends. They are ideal for bulk storage of identical, non-perishable items, but require specialized forklifts and prioritize LIFO flow.

  • Cantilever Racking: The Long and Lean Champion

Need a solution for long or oddly-shaped items like pipes or lumber? Cantilever racking comes to the rescue. Imagine shelves jutting out from a single upright post. This system provides easy access to individual items and is perfect for storing bulky goods that don't require frequent handling.

Choosing Your Champion: Matching Racking to Your Needs

Here's a quick reference guide to help you select the optimal racking system:

  • High Volume, Fast-Moving Inventory (FIFO): Selective racking, carton flow racking (for smaller items).
  • Space Optimization, Low Pick Frequency (LIFO): Double deep racking, push-back racking, drive-in/drive-thru racking (for bulk storage).
  • Long or Bulky Items: Cantilever racking.

Remember:

  • Always prioritize safety when considering weight capacity and proper loading procedures.
  • Consult with a professional racking supplier to assess your specific warehouse needs and recommend the most suitable system.
